Transaction 204742bc715a65ea86128104343c3fae68e6d7b262d911c855ca7280e09b229e
1 Input
2 Outputs
- 204742bc715a65ea86128104343c3fae68e6d7b262d911c855ca7280e09b229e:0
- 204742bc715a65ea86128104343c3fae68e6d7b262d911c855ca7280e09b229e:1
value 591597862
address 12jJw81GLiyp3E3x9bGyzCC5TkLGWQZepA
value 1557773
address 1EzDFVis5o6b4M5ehBHt6STNgEfXr5f7jw